Kết nối nguồn dữ liệu Power Query
Power Query cung cấp nhiều trình kết nối khác nhau để nhập dữ liệu, hầu hết đều hỗ trợ Dynamics 365 Customer Insights . Trong Power Query tham chiếu trình kết nối, các trình kết nối có dấu kiểm trong cột Thông tin chuyên sâu về khách hàng (Luồng dữ liệu) bạn có thể sử dụng để nhập dữ liệu tới Customer Insights - Data. Xem lại tài liệu về một trình kết nối cụ thể để tìm hiểu thêm về các điều kiện tiên quyết, các giới hạn truy vấn và các chi tiết khác.
Power Query có kích thước dữ liệu và giới hạn hiệu suất. Nó tạo bản sao của dữ liệu trong Dataverse kho dữ liệu được quản lý ở định dạng CSV nên việc đồng bộ hóa dữ liệu mất nhiều thời gian hơn so với các kết nối nguồn dữ liệu khác.
Để kết nối dữ liệu một cách an toàn trong mạng riêng, Power Query hỗ trợ sử dụng cổng dữ liệu mạng ảo (bản xem trước).
Tạo một nguồn dữ liệu mới
Đi đến Dữ liệu>Nguồn dữ liệu.
Chọn Thêm nguồn dữ liệu.
Chọn Microsoft Power Query.
Cung cấp Tên và Mô tả không bắt buộc cho nguồn dữ liệu rồi chọn Tiếp theo.
Chọn một trong những trình kết nối có sẵn. Trong ví dụ này, chúng tôi chọn trình kết nối Text/CSV .
Nhập thông tin chi tiết bắt buộc vào Cài đặt kết nối cho trình kết nối đã chọn và chọn Tiếp theo để xem bản xem trước của dữ liệu.
Chọn Chuyển đổi dữ liệu.
Xem lại và tinh chỉnh dữ liệu của bạn trong trang Power Query - Chỉnh sửa truy vấn . Các bảng mà hệ thống đã xác định trong nguồn dữ liệu đã chọn của bạn xuất hiện ở khung bên trái.
Chuyển đổi dữ liệu của bạn. Chọn một bảng để chỉnh sửa hoặc chuyển đổi. Để áp dụng các phép biến đổi, hãy sử dụng các tùy chọn trong cửa sổ Power Query . Mỗi phép chuyển đổi được liệt kê trong Các bước áp dụng. Power Query cung cấp nhiều tùy chọn chuyển đổi dựng sẵn .
Quan trọng
Chúng tôi khuyên bạn nên sử dụng các phép biến đổi sau:
- Nếu bạn đang nhập dữ liệu từ tệp CSV, hàng đầu tiên thường chứa các tiêu đề. Đi tới Chuyển đổi và chọn Sử dụng hàng đầu tiên làm tiêu đề.
- Đảm bảo loại dữ liệu được đặt phù hợp và khớp với dữ liệu. Ví dụ: đối với trường ngày, hãy chọn loại ngày.
Để thêm nhiều bảng hơn vào nguồn dữ liệu của bạn trong hộp thoại Chỉnh sửa truy vấn , hãy đi tới Trang chủ và chọn Lấy dữ liệu. Lặp lại các bước 5-10 cho đến khi bạn thêm tất cả các bảng cho nguồn dữ liệu này. Nếu bạn có cơ sở dữ liệu bao gồm nhiều tập dữ liệu thì mỗi tập dữ liệu là một bảng riêng.
Chọn xem bạn muốn làm mới nguồn dữ liệu theo cách thủ công hay tự động. Để tự động làm mới, hãy đặt khung thời gian.
Chọn Lưu. Trang Nguồn dữ liệu mở ra hiển thị nguồn dữ liệu mới ở trạng thái Đang làm mới .
Tiền bo
Có trạng thái cho các nhiệm vụ và quy trình. Hầu hết các quy trình đều phụ thuộc vào các quy trình ngược dòng khác, chẳng hạn như nguồn dữ liệu và lập hồ sơ dữ liệu làm mới.
Chọn trạng thái để mở ngăn Chi tiết tiến độ và xem tiến trình của nhiệm vụ. Để hủy công việc, hãy chọn Hủy công việc ở cuối ngăn.
Trong mỗi nhiệm vụ, bạn có thể chọn Xem chi tiết để biết thêm thông tin về tiến độ, chẳng hạn như thời gian xử lý, ngày xử lý cuối cùng cũng như mọi lỗi và cảnh báo hiện hành liên quan đến nhiệm vụ hoặc quy trình. Chọn Xem trạng thái hệ thống ở cuối bảng để xem các quy trình khác trong hệ thống.
Quá trình tải dữ liệu có thể mất một khoảng thời gian. Sau khi làm mới thành công, dữ liệu đã nhập có thể được xem lại từ trang Dữ liệu>Bảng .
Thận trọng
- Nguồn dữ liệu dựa trên Power Query tạo ra luồng dữ liệu trong Dataverse. Không thay đổi tên của luồng dữ liệu trong Power Platform trung tâm quản trị được sử dụng trong Customer Insights - Data. Việc đổi tên luồng dữ liệu sẽ gây ra sự cố với các tham chiếu giữa nguồn dữ liệu và Dataverse luồng dữ liệu.
- Các đánh giá đồng thời cho Power Query nguồn dữ liệu trong Customer Insights - Data có cùng giới hạn làm mới như Luồng dữ liệu trong PowerBI.com. Nếu quá trình làm mới dữ liệu không thành công do đã đạt đến giới hạn đánh giá, chúng tôi khuyên bạn nên điều chỉnh lịch làm mới cho từng luồng dữ liệu để đảm bảo các nguồn dữ liệu không được xử lý cùng một lúc.
Thêm dữ liệu từ nguồn dữ liệu tại chỗ
Việc nhập dữ liệu từ nguồn dữ liệu tại chỗ được hỗ trợ dựa trên Microsoft Power Platform luồng dữ liệu (PPDF). Bạn có thể kích hoạt luồng dữ liệu trong Customer Insights - Data bằng cách cung cấp Microsoft Dataverse URL môi trường khi thiết lập môi trường.
Các nguồn dữ liệu được tạo sau khi liên kết một Dataverse môi trường với Customer Insights - Data sử dụng Power Platform luồng dữ liệu theo mặc định. Luồng dữ liệu hỗ trợ kết nối tại chỗ bằng cổng dữ liệu. Bạn có thể xóa và tạo lại các nguồn dữ liệu tồn tại trước khi Dataverse môi trường được liên kết bằng cách sử dụng tại chỗ cổng dữ liệu.
Cổng dữ liệu từ môi trường Power BI hoặc Power Apps hiện có sẽ hiển thị và bạn có thể sử dụng lại chúng trong Customer Insights nếu cổng dữ liệu và môi trường Customer Insights ở cùng một Khu vực Azure. Trang nguồn dữ liệu hiển thị các liên kết đi đến môi trường Microsoft Power Platform nơi bạn có thể xem và định cấu hình cổng dữ liệu tại chỗ.
Các thực tiễn tốt nhất và khắc phục sự cố
Vì cổng dữ liệu tại chỗ nằm trong mạng của tổ chức nên Microsoft không thể kiểm tra tình trạng của cổng đó. Các đề xuất sau đây có thể giúp giải quyết thời gian chờ của cổng khi nhập dữ liệu vào Customer Insights:
Theo dõi và tối ưu hóa hiệu suất của cổng dữ liệu tại chỗ và làm theo tại chỗ hướng dẫn định cỡ cổng dữ liệu.
Tách biệt luồng dữ liệu nhập và chuyển đổi. Việc tách các luồng dữ liệu để nhập và chuyển đổi rất hữu ích khi xử lý nhiều truy vấn của các nguồn dữ liệu chậm hơn trong một luồng dữ liệu hoặc nhiều luồng dữ liệu truy vấn cùng một nguồn dữ liệu.
Đảm bảo tất cả các nút cổng dữ liệu tại chỗ đều hoạt động tốt và được định cấu hình ở độ trễ mạng hợp lý giữa các nút và nguồn dữ liệu cho các phiên bản SQL.
Sử dụng cụm cổng dữ liệu có thể mở rộng nếu bạn mong đợi các yêu cầu dữ liệu lớn.
Đảm bảo nguồn dữ liệu được chia tỷ lệ phù hợp và mức sử dụng tài nguyên trên nguồn không cao bất thường.
Xem xét việc phân vùng các bảng lớn thành các bảng nhỏ hơn.
Hãy cân nhắc việc lưu trữ nguồn dữ liệu và cổng dữ liệu trong cùng một khu vực địa lý.
Tối ưu hóa truy vấn và chỉ mục nguồn dữ liệu. Dữ liệu được lập chỉ mục và phân vùng đúng cách có thể được truy cập nhanh chóng và hiệu quả hơn, dẫn đến hiệu suất truy vấn và luồng dữ liệu tốt hơn.
Quan trọng
Cập nhật cổng của bạn lên phiên bản mới nhất. Bạn có thể cài đặt bản cập nhật và định cấu hình lại cổng từ lời nhắc hiển thị trực tiếp trên màn hình cổng hoặc tải xuống phiên bản mới nhất. Nếu bạn không sử dụng phiên bản cổng mới nhất thì quá trình làm mới luồng dữ liệu sẽ không thành công với các thông báo lỗi như Từ khóa không được hỗ trợ: thuộc tính cấu hình. Tên tham số: từ khóa.
Lỗi với cổng dữ liệu tại chỗ thường do vấn đề cấu hình gây ra. Để biết thêm thông tin về cách khắc phục sự cố cổng dữ liệu, hãy xem Khắc phục sự cố cổng dữ liệu tại chỗ.
Chỉnh sửa Power Query nguồn dữ liệu
Bạn phải là chủ sở hữu của luồng dữ liệu để chỉnh sửa nó.
Lưu ý
Có thể không thực hiện được thay đổi đối với nguồn dữ liệu hiện đang được sử dụng trong một trong các quy trình của ứng dụng (ví dụ: phân đoạn hoặc hợp nhất dữ liệu).
Trong trang Cài đặt , bạn có thể theo dõi tiến trình của từng quy trình đang hoạt động. Khi quá trình hoàn tất, bạn có thể quay lại trang Nguồn dữ liệu và thực hiện các thay đổi của mình.
Đi đến Dữ liệu>Nguồn dữ liệu. Bên cạnh nguồn dữ liệu bạn muốn cập nhật, hãy chọn Chỉnh sửa.
Áp dụng các thay đổi và chuyển đổi của bạn trong hộp thoại Power Query - Chỉnh sửa truy vấn như được mô tả trong phần Tạo phần nguồn dữ liệu mới.
Chọn Lưu để áp dụng các thay đổi của bạn và quay lại trang Nguồn dữ liệu .
Tiền bo
Có trạng thái cho các nhiệm vụ và quy trình. Hầu hết các quy trình đều phụ thuộc vào các quy trình ngược dòng khác, chẳng hạn như nguồn dữ liệu và lập hồ sơ dữ liệu làm mới.
Chọn trạng thái để mở ngăn Chi tiết tiến độ và xem tiến trình của nhiệm vụ. Để hủy công việc, hãy chọn Hủy công việc ở cuối ngăn.
Trong mỗi nhiệm vụ, bạn có thể chọn Xem chi tiết để biết thêm thông tin về tiến độ, chẳng hạn như thời gian xử lý, ngày xử lý cuối cùng cũng như mọi lỗi và cảnh báo hiện hành liên quan đến nhiệm vụ hoặc quy trình. Chọn Xem trạng thái hệ thống ở cuối bảng để xem các quy trình khác trong hệ thống.
Quá trình tải dữ liệu có thể mất một khoảng thời gian. Sau khi làm mới thành công, hãy xem lại dữ liệu đã nhập từ trang Dữ liệu>Bảng .
Chuyến hàng Power Query nguồn dữ liệu quyền sở hữu
Bạn có thể chuyến hàng quyền sở hữu nguồn dữ liệu cho những người khác trong tổ chức của bạn. Ví dụ: nếu chủ sở hữu rời khỏi tổ chức hoặc nếu cần có những thay đổi vì mục đích cộng tác.
Chuyến hàng quyền sở hữu
Người dùng thực hiện hành động này phải có vai trò Dataverse Quản trị viên .
Truy cập Power Apps.
Chọn môi trường Dataverse ánh xạ tới môi trường Customer Insights - Data của bạn.
Đi tới Luồng dữ liệu và chọn Tất cả luồng dữ liệu.
Tìm kiếm chủ sở hữu của luồng dữ liệu mà bạn muốn sở hữu.
Chọn dấu chấm lửng dọc (⋮) và chọn Thay đổi chủ sở hữu.
Nhập tên chủ sở hữu mới và chọn Thay đổi chủ sở hữu.
Cập nhật Power Query lịch biểu làm mới hệ thống
Customer Insights - Data đang điều chỉnh Power Query lịch làm mới riêng biệt với lịch làm mới hệ thống. Để đảm bảo rằng Customer Insights - Data phản ánh dữ liệu hiện tại, hãy xóa Power Query lịch làm mới của bạn để các nguồn dữ liệu này làm mới như một phần của quá trình làm mới hệ thống. Nếu Power Query nguồn dữ liệu của bạn hiển thị Đã hoàn thành với cảnh báo trên trang Nguồn dữ liệu , thì nguồn dữ liệu chứa lịch làm mới riêng. Loại bỏ lịch trình riêng biệt. Sau khi làm mới hệ thống, trạng thái sẽ thay đổi thành Đã hoàn thành.
Quan trọng
Thời gian làm mới nguồn dữ liệu được thêm vào tổng thời gian làm mới hệ thống. Chúng tôi khuyên bạn nên xem Power Query thời lượng chạy rồi thay đổi lịch làm mới hệ thống Nếu cần thiết. Ví dụ: một nguồn Power Query có thể mất trung bình 30 phút để làm mới. Do đó, chúng tôi khuyên bạn nên cập nhật lịch làm mới hệ thống để bắt đầu sớm hơn 30 phút để nhận kết quả vào thời điểm tương tự.
Xóa Power Query lịch trình
Chuyển đến Dữ liệu>Nguồn dữ liệu.
Chọn Power Query nguồn dữ liệu mong muốn.
Chọn dấu chấm lửng dọc (⋮) và chọn Chỉnh sửa cài đặt làm mới.
Chọn Làm mới thủ công.
Chọn Lưu.
Xem Power Query thời lượng chạy
Chuyển đến Dữ liệu>Nguồn dữ liệu.
Chọn Power Query nguồn dữ liệu mong muốn.
Chọn Trạng thái.
Làm mới Power Query nguồn dữ liệu theo yêu cầu
Chỉ chủ sở hữu của a Power Query nguồn dữ liệu mới có thể làm mới nguồn dữ liệu theo yêu cầu. Nếu bạn không phải là chủ sở hữu của nguồn dữ liệu, hãy tìm chủ sở hữu nguồn dữ liệu trong Được người khác quản lý trên Nguồn dữ liệu trang.
Chuyển đến Dữ liệu>Nguồn dữ liệu.
Chọn Power Query nguồn dữ liệu mong muốn rồi chọn Làm mới.